在计算机操作系统中,命令提示符(CMD)和批处理脚本都是我们日常工作中常用的工具。CMD可以让我们直接与系统交互,而批处理脚本则可以让我们自动化执行一系列命令。那么,如何从CMD过渡到批处理,实现自动化任务管理呢?本文将为你详细解答。
CMD与批处理的区别
首先,让我们来了解一下CMD和批处理之间的区别。
CMD
命令提示符(CMD)是一个交互式命令行解释器,它允许用户直接输入命令来执行各种操作。CMD的强大之处在于其强大的命令行工具和丰富的命令集。
批处理
批处理是一种脚本语言,用于自动化执行一系列命令。批处理脚本通常以.bat或.cmd为扩展名,可以在CMD中直接运行。
批处理的优点
相较于CMD,批处理脚本具有以下优点:
- 自动化:批处理脚本可以自动化执行一系列命令,节省时间和精力。
- 可重复性:批处理脚本可以重复执行,无需手动输入命令。
- 灵活性:批处理脚本可以根据不同的需求进行修改和扩展。
如何从CMD过渡到批处理
以下是一些帮助你从CMD过渡到批处理的步骤:
1. 学习批处理语法
批处理脚本的基本语法如下:
@echo off
echo 开始执行批处理脚本
rem 这是一个注释,不会被执行
echo 执行第一个命令
cmd /c command1
echo 执行第二个命令
cmd /c command2
echo 批处理脚本执行完毕
2. 创建批处理文件
在Windows系统中,你可以使用记事本等文本编辑器创建批处理文件。以下是一个简单的批处理文件示例:
@echo off
echo 欢迎使用批处理脚本
echo 正在执行任务...
pause
echo 任务完成!
pause
3. 运行批处理文件
将上述代码保存为example.bat,然后在CMD中运行该文件:
example
4. 修改和扩展批处理脚本
根据你的需求,你可以修改和扩展批处理脚本,例如添加循环、条件判断等。
批处理应用实例
以下是一些批处理脚本的应用实例:
- 自动下载文件:使用
wget或curl命令下载文件。 - 自动备份文件:定期将重要文件备份到其他位置。
- 自动清理垃圾文件:删除临时文件和缓存文件。
- 自动更新软件:检查软件版本,并自动下载和安装最新版本。
总结
通过学习批处理脚本,你可以轻松实现自动化任务管理。从CMD过渡到批处理,不仅可以提高工作效率,还可以让你更加熟悉Windows操作系统的使用。希望本文能帮助你掌握批处理脚本,实现自动化任务管理。
